diff --git a/.github/workflows/CI.yml b/.github/workflows/CI.yml index 8bd57519a..263c12c7a 100644 --- a/.github/workflows/CI.yml +++ b/.github/workflows/CI.yml @@ -50,6 +50,8 @@ jobs: ${{ runner.os }}-test- ${{ runner.os }}- - uses: julia-actions/julia-buildpkg@v1 + - if: ${{ matrix.group == 'OptimizationQuadDIRECT' }} + run: julia --project -e 'using Pkg; Pkg.Registry.add(RegistrySpec(url = "https://github.com/HolyLab/HolyLabRegistry.git")); Pkg.add("QuadDIRECT")' - uses: julia-actions/julia-runtest@v1 env: GROUP: ${{ matrix.group }} diff --git a/lib/OptimizationQuadDIRECT/Project.toml b/lib/OptimizationQuadDIRECT/Project.toml index 29e743abe..f55b73246 100644 --- a/lib/OptimizationQuadDIRECT/Project.toml +++ b/lib/OptimizationQuadDIRECT/Project.toml @@ -5,10 +5,11 @@ version = "0.1.0" [deps] Optimization = "7f7a1694-90dd-40f0-9382-eb1efda571ba" +QuadDIRECT = "dae52e8d-d666-5120-a592-9e15c33b8d7a" [compat] -julia = "1" Optimization = "3" +julia = "1" [extras] Pkg = "44cfe95a-1eb2-52ea-b672-e2afdf69b78f" diff --git a/lib/OptimizationQuadDIRECT/test/runtests.jl b/lib/OptimizationQuadDIRECT/test/runtests.jl index af584ccdf..2d4a857c1 100644 --- a/lib/OptimizationQuadDIRECT/test/runtests.jl +++ b/lib/OptimizationQuadDIRECT/test/runtests.jl @@ -1,5 +1,3 @@ -using Pkg; -Pkg.develop(url = "https://github.com/timholy/QuadDIRECT.jl.git"); using OptimizationQuadDIRECT, Optimization using Test